Summary: I had Math class with Alex
Comment: At Montgomery Village Middle School, in Montgomery County, Maryland, I was priviledged enough to have the opportunity to have Algebra 1 class with Alex, in 1999. To this day, those in that class still remember him, for how brilliant he obviously was and is. At times, he had to correct our teacher, one who had been teaching algebra for thirty years. He would finish his work and begin working on trigonometry and calculus problems, at least four years ahead of most other student's pace. Not only was he exceedingly bright, he was an honest and trustworthy student. Never would Alex let anyone even take a peek at his paper. And, on top of that, he would sometimes attempt to tell us jokes or tell us about his favorite sports teams. Everyone in the class knew he was autistic, or at the least was not "normal." Howver, he was the most liked student in the class. I have not read this book, but plan to. I just wanted to tell some people of my own experiences with this exceptional person. I wish Alex the best of luck, though, knowing him, I'm sure he would attempt to disprove any theories relating to luck altogether.

Comment: A Different Kind Of Boy: A Father's Memoir About Raising A Gifted Child with Autism is the personal memoir of Daniel Mont, the father of an autistic boy. Daniel's fourth grade son Alex has difficulty interacting with the world and other people, is prone to anxiety, and has no real friends. But Alex is an amazing child prodigy in math, and one of seven fourth graders in the United States to ace the National Math Olympiad. A Different Kind Of Boy is a heartfelt, candid, and ultimately inspiring tale of the struggle of a father to teach his gifted child the awareness the boy needs to survive and connect with others, while making the most of his prodigious talents. A Different Kind Of Boy is highly recommended reading for any parent of an autistic or specially gifted child.

Comment: I, too, have a high-functioning very smart son with autism about the same age as the boy in this book, so I ordered "A Different Kind of Boy" as soon as I heard about it. I loved it. The way the author showed the events in his family's life and the evolution of his and his wife's perspective was wonderful. I identified with most of the author's experiences, especially those involving interactions with schools and teachers. Besides my autistic son, I have two other sons with different disorders. The frustrations the author in had dealing with trying to get the world to "get it" applies to all three of my sons' situations. I highly recommend this terrific book for teachers, medical professionals, and especially for parents of children with any special needs.
